The Discovery Chemistry & Technologies organization within Lilly Research 
Laboratories is a diverse and dynamic group seeking a highly skilled scientist 
to join the structural biology team. We support drug discovery for numerous 
innovative projects and are looking for someone to inspire change in the drug 
hunting process. The primary focus will be to lead in the development and 
deployment of methodologies to accelerate structure-based drug design. Broad 
experience with proteins, along with a proven track record of structural 
determination is required. We are a diverse team of scientists and strive for 
excellence and innovative solutions to find therapies for our patients. Join 
our team today and make an impact!
Required Experience and Skills

  *   Expert in protein crystallography including crystallization, structure 
determination and analysis; experience with construct design, protein 
expression and purification
  *   Experience determining structures by cryo-EM will be a plus
  *   Ability to lead several structural biology projects in parallel
  *   Partner closely with biologists, biophysicists, biochemists, structural 
biologists, and medicinal chemists to develop integrative approaches to enable 
targets and address specific project needs
  *   Work closely with groups within structural biology, and as a member of 
broader teams that may include synthetic chemists, computational chemists, 
biologists, enzymologists, and ADME scientists
  *   Ability to generate macromolecular structures and communicate the 
relevant results to a diverse drug discovery team, and the capacity to 
contribute to small-molecule design efforts
